/// Peer-to-peer network configuration.
#[derive(DataSize, Debug, Clone, Deserialize, Serialize)]
// Disallow unknown fields to ensure config files and command-line overrides contain valid keys.
#[serde(deny_unknown_fields)]
pub struct Config {
    /// Address to bind to.
    pub bind_address: String,
    /// Known address of a node on the network used for joining.
    pub known_addresses: Vec<String>,
    /// Whether this node is a bootstrap node or not.  A boostrap node will continue to run even if
    /// it has no peer connections, and is intended to be amongst the first nodes started on a
    /// network.
    pub is_bootstrap_node: bool,
    /// Enable systemd startup notification.
    pub systemd_support: bool,
    /// The timeout for connection setup (including upgrades) for all inbound and outbound
    /// connections.
    pub connection_setup_timeout: TimeDiff,
    /// The maximum serialized one-way message size in bytes.
    pub max_one_way_message_size: u32,
    /// The timeout for inbound and outbound requests.
    pub request_timeout: TimeDiff,
    /// The keep-alive timeout of idle connections.
    pub connection_keep_alive: TimeDiff,
    /// Interval used for gossip heartbeats.
    pub gossip_heartbeat_interval: TimeDiff,
    /// Maximum serialized gossip message size in bytes.
    pub max_gossip_message_size: u32,
    /// Time for which to retain a cached gossip message ID to prevent duplicates being gossiped.
    pub gossip_duplicate_cache_timeout: TimeDiff,
}
